Anine Aasen
16 October - 21 November 2026

Anine Aasen

Upcoming exhibition
  • Overview
  • Related Artists
Overview
Anine Aasen lives and works in Bergen, Norway. She works primarily as a painter.
 
Aasen's use of color is enticing, her figuration and abstraction dynamic. Different fragments from everyday objects, spaces and light melt together creating new conversations. In one section of her paintings, she works meticulously with pattern or motif. In another, she breaks figuration and goes abstract. Her works seem intimate, well-known, intriguing, and strange at the same time.
 
Aasen graduated with her MFA from The Art Academy in Bergen in the spring of 2024.
 
This marks the artist's first exhibition in the gallery, and we are very excited to present her work.
